Output 165046248eba751389e95d0a094d6cd7f79dbeac245990b446a1e0896d21461c:1

value
95124
script pubkey
OP_0 OP_PUSHBYTES_20 e87393d84e607aa3da31aa18818b49fa496e58ca
address
tb1qapee8kzwvpa28k334gvgrz6flfykukx23lqlzf
transaction
165046248eba751389e95d0a094d6cd7f79dbeac245990b446a1e0896d21461c
confirmations
102999
spent
true